Transformative Emerging Technologies in UK Computing

In the dynamic UK tech landscape, several emerging technologies drive rapid innovation. Foremost among these are artificial intelligence (AI), quantum computing, and the Internet of Things (IoT). AI technologies are increasingly embedded across sectors, enhancing data analysis, automating complex tasks, and enabling intelligent decision-making. The UK’s strong AI research foundation supports robust development and adoption.

Quantum computing represents a groundbreaking frontier within UK computing innovations. UK research institutions and companies are pioneering advances in qubit stability and error correction, aiming for practical, scalable quantum processors. These technologies promise to revolutionize cryptography, optimization, and simulation tasks.

The IoT ecosystem in the UK is expanding swiftly, linking devices and systems for smarter cities, healthcare, and manufacturing. This connectivity fuels efficiencies and creates new business models adapted to digital transformation. Recent breakthroughs in sensor technology and edge computing fortify IoT’s real-world applications across the UK.

Together, these emerging technologies underscore the transformative potential of UK computing innovations. Their development and integration are central to the country’s ambition to lead globally in next-generation digital infrastructure.
